MARA Holdings Appoints Two New Independent Directors
MARA Holdings, Inc. announced the resignation of two directors, Barbara Humpton and Georges Antoun, effective July 31, 2026, and the appointment of Craig Hart and Nancy Novak as independent directors, effective August 1, 2026. The new directors bring expertise in power infrastructure, energy investing, and hyperscale data center development, aligning with MARA's strategy to integrate energy, digital infrastructure, and compute. The appointments are part of a planned transition and will result in a Board comprising seven directors, six of whom are independent.

About Mara Holdings Inc.
Mara Holdings Inc. is a company that primarily specializes in the financial and technological sectors, focusing on innovative endeavors within its portfolio. As part of its core business model, Mara Holdings engages in cryptocurrency mining and digital asset management, which positions it in the rapidly evolving digital finance industry. Its operations include mining of major cryptocurrencies, which involves the validation of digital transactions and adding them to a blockchain ledger, a process crucial to the functionality and security of cryptocurrency networks.
